Python版本>=3.4不提供可工作的PIP实用程序。似乎不可能在之后添加它

2024-05-20 00:01:05 发布

您现在位置:Python中文网/ 问答频道 /正文

Python3.6安装了PIP,但在安装时无法访问它。没有在安装状态下调用的代码。我已经阅读了关于这个问题的所有建议,但没有成功

甚至升级都不起作用

user@loco:~/devstack$pip安装--升级pip


Tags: pip代码状态建议userdevstackloco
1条回答
网友
1楼 · 发布于 2024-05-20 00:01:05

是的,Python3.6安装了PIP,但在安装时无法访问它。如果有办法触发已安装的PIP,那对我来说是个谜!在经历了许多痛苦之后,我找到了一种更新已安装版本的方法,即PIP版本9.xxx。这是对我有用的东西

root@bx:/usr/local/lib/python3.6/site-packages # python -m pip install  upgrade pip

该命令创建了一个PIP,现在可以在我的FreeBSD服务器上的任何位置正常工作!由Python3.6安装交付的PIP只能通过首先调用Python来工作。一旦以这种方式调用,它将使用最新版本更新到版本9。就我而言,它是19.xxx版本。有趣的是,它立即变得全球化,从任何地方都可以访问,所以不需要使用端口等

显然,所安装的工具无法正常工作,正如Python3.6所安装的那样。运行它们的唯一方法是调用Python和您可以在发出的命令中看到的所需Python文件。然而,一旦调用了更新,新的PIP就可以全局工作,而不必显式调用Python3.6

请记住,如果您的命令“python”调用python2.7,您将无法完成升级。为此,您必须处理端口或调用我随Python3.6提供的命令,或调用3.x版python的任何命令

相关问题 更多 >